Steps to view permissions in Drive

Google Drive allows us to share a document or file with anyone we want. We can enter the mail of a friend or relative and have access to read or edit. We can even make it available to anyone, even if they are not related to us. For example, in the latter case it could be a document that we want to share on social networks so that anyone can read it.

But what happens if you have a file that you have uploaded to the cloud and you doubt if someone outside of you can access it? Maybe you just shared something to send to a friend or family member. Luckily, you can easily see what permissions you’ve granted and modify them if necessary.

The first thing you need to do is log into your Drive account. You put your personal data and password and enter the account. Once there you have to enter the My unit section and all the documents and files that you have uploaded to this platform will appear. You simply have to right-click on the one that interests you and click on Share .

You will automatically see all the users with whom you have shared that file. You’ll see if they have permissions to edit, read, or comment. Also, if you want to remove someone you just have to click Remove . You will automatically no longer have access to the permissions granted to read, edit or comment on that file or document.

Likewise, you can add users so that they have access to those permissions. You can add as many as you want, simply putting the corresponding email. You can also make it public to anyone. However, the latter is not advisable if it is a private document that contains data that should not be exposed.

At the bottom, you can see the option to share via link . You can allow anyone with access to the link to read the content, edit it, etc. You simply have to click on the drop-down menu and select if you want it to be restricted or allow anyone with a link to enter.

You can also mark if you want to have access to edit the document or only read. If, for example, you are going to share a text document and you want it to be available to anyone with a link but you do not want them to modify or delete it, simply check the Read option.

How to protect Drive files

We have explained that you can easily see who has access to those documents and files that you have uploaded. You can give or remove permissions so they can read, comment or edit any of those documents. But now we are going to explain how you should protect it.

Ideally, if you’re uploading files for yourself, don’t share them with anyone. If, for example, it is about documents that you want to have available anywhere, backup copies, folders that you upload to free up space on your mobile… All this should be protected, without you sharing it with anyone.

The way to find out if it is properly protected is to make sure that it is not shared with anyone and that they cannot access that document through a link. That means that only we can enter to read or edit that file . If we see something strange, it is best that we remove possible permissions granted by mistake as soon as possible.

protect the account

The first tip for uploading and keeping your files totally safe in Drive is to protect your account. This means that we must configure a good password to avoid unwanted access. That key must contain letters (both uppercase and lowercase), numbers, and other special symbols. All this randomly and never use the same key in other places.

It is also important to activate two-step authentication , something that we can do in Google services. It is an extra security barrier that can help us protect our account and thus avoid possible attacks. A hypothetical intruder would need a second step to gain entry.

Use official apps

An also important point is to use only official applications . It is true that sometimes we can find third-party programs that may have certain additional functions that seem interesting, but the truth is that we have no guarantees that our data will be protected.

A hacker could have maliciously modified that program to steal our login details. We must always try to use only official software and that it is correctly updated. In this way we will protect the account and, at the same time, the files that we host in this service.

Upload encrypted files

If you want to maximize privacy and avoid problems, an alternative is to upload encrypted files to Drive . You should especially keep this in mind if you are going to host content that may be sensitive. For example text files, images, etc. In this way you will avoid possible problems with intruders.

There are different tools to encrypt files. For example, we can name AES Crypt, AxCrypt, BitLocker or VeraCrypt. All of them act very well to encrypt any type of document or file that we upload to Google Drive or any other platform in the cloud.
